The CPI SAT (formerly GD Satcom Technologies & Prodelin) 9.2M Ka-Band antenna delivers extraordinary performance for broadband hub & Ka-Band Satcom applications. Large diameter Ka-band antennas require unique design criteria which CPI has successfully demonstrated with both the 9.2 and 13.2 meter products.
Reflector Tolerance
Items such as reflector surface accuracy, antenna/ feed design, structural antenna stiffness and integrity, thermal effects, anti-icing, HPA phase combining, monopulse tracking, installation and alignments and hub integration all require special engineering expertise at Ka-band.

Optics Configuration |
Cassegrain |
|
|
Frequency Transmit Receive |
Standard Band 28.35-30.00 GHz 18.30-20.20 GHz |
Custom Band 27.50-31.00 GHz 17.70-21.20 GHz |
|
Antenna Gain (Standard Band) Transmit @ Feed Tx Port Input Receive @ LNA Input |
66.1+20Log(F/30.0) dBi63.2+20Log(F/20.2) dBi |
|
|
G/T (min) @ 30° Elevation and 120K LNA (Standard Band) |
39.2 + 20 Log (F/20.2) dBi/K (includes Feed to LNA losses for 1:2 LNA Redundancy) |
|
|
Polarization (Transmit and Receive) |
Dual Circular (RHCP/LHCP) |
|
|
3 dB Beamwidth Transmit Receive |
0.08° 0.12° |
|
|
Axial Ratio @ 1dB BW (X-POL Isolation in dB) |
0.5 dB (30.7 dB) |
|
|
Port to Port Isolation Transmit to Receive Receive to Transmit Transmit to Transmit Receive to Recieve |
85 dB 85 dB 20 dB 20 dB |
|
|
VSWR |
1.35:1 Max |
|
|
Sidelobe Performance (Tx/Rx) |
ITU-RS.580-5 FCC CFR-47 & 25.209 |
|
|
Power Handling |
1 kW CW Per Port, 2 kW Total |
|
|
Feed Waveguide Flange |
Rx (WR-42), Tx (WR-34) |
|
|
Pressurization Operational Maximum |
0.5 psi2.0 psi |
|
|
Elevation Travel |
0 to 90° Continuous |
|
|
Azimuth Travel |
±90° Continuous |
|
|
Axis Velocity |
0.5°/s |
|
|
Axis Acceleration |
0.2°/s2 |
|
|
Azimuth Drive Configuration |
Gear and Pinion, Single Motor Drive |
|
|
Elevation Drive Configuration |
Jackscrew, Single Motor Drive |
|
|
Motor Type for Azimuth and Elevation |
Servo Motor |
|
|
Antenna Two-Axis Pointing Performance (over 10 degree of axis travel) |
0.0066° RMS, No Wind0.0140° RMS Winds 30 mph gusting to 45 mph |
|
|
Tracking Performance for Optrack (C/No: 45 dB-Hz) |
0.0041° RMS, No Wind0.0084° RMS Winds 45 mph gusting to 60 mph |
|
|
Tracking Performance for Monopulse (C/No: 45 dB-Hz) |
0.0041° RMS, No Wind0.0047° RMS Winds 45 mph gusting to 60 mph |
|
|
Tracking Modes |
Program TrackOptrack /Step Track Monopulse |
|
|
Anti-Icing |
Feed Blower Heated Subreflector Optional Primary Reflector – Gas or Electric (as required) |
